Electric vehicle drivers are likely to be hit with a new “pay-per-mile” tax in the forthcoming budget, amounting to an extra £250 a year on average. The scheme, which would charge EV motorists 3p per mile on top of other road taxes, comes amid falling fuel duty revenue as more people switch from petrol to electric.
